Job Overview

Provides administrative support to members of the Senior Leadership team, serves as a liaison between senior-level employees and their departments, oversees specific projects relevant to their function, and coordinates internal relations efforts.

Job Requirements

Key Responsibilities 
• Support Plant Leadership Team meetings, reviews, follow-ups, and action tracking 
• Assist with continuous improvement activities, project coordination, and progress updates 
• Help bridge communication between senior leaders, engineers, managers, supervisors, 
and shopfloor teams 
• Coordinate arrangements for international visitors, including meeting schedules, plant visit 
flow, logistics, and hospitality support 
• Prepare meeting notes, action lists, simple reports, presentation materials, and follow-up 
summaries 
• Support improvement activities related to productivity, quality, 5S, training, output recovery, 
and problem-solving 
• Follow up with responsible owners to ensure actions are completed on time 
• Assist in organizing plant events, leadership visits, workshops, and cross-functional reviews 
• Be willing to occasionally support outside normal working hours when required for 
important visitors, plant activities, or urgent business needs.
